Abstract
The invention discloses a kind of terminal control method and terminal devices, the terminal control method is applied to terminal device, it include: the working frequency obtained when storage card and radio circuit work at the same time, the working frequency includes the second working frequency that the first working frequency that the storage card carries out data transmission and the radio circuit carry out signal transmission;When second working frequency is the frequency multiplication frequency of first working frequency, suspend the data transmission of the storage card.The embodiment of the present invention, when the second working frequency that radio circuit carries out signal transmission is the frequency multiplication frequency for the first working frequency that storage card carries out data transmission, determine that the data transmission of storage card generates interference to the signal transmission of radio circuit, control storage card pause data transmission at this time, and then the working time for the Data transmitting and receiving signal that can control storage card is staggered, the interference for effectively avoiding radio frequency receiving signal from being transmitted by storing card data.

Background technique
With the development of communication, smart phone is developed rapidly, since user is more and more multiple using the environment of mobile phone
It is miscellaneous, therefore the requirement to antenna performance more wants high.User uses wireless network or long term evolution (Long Term
Evolution, LTE) network downloading data when, may be directly downloaded in storage card, therefore storage card has data at this time
Transmission.If position is arranged in the antenna of LTE network or wireless network and the positional distance of storage card is smaller, storage card is being carried out
When data are transmitted, when LTE network or wireless network reception signal frequency storage card data signal line frequency
When times frequency point, the interference transmitted by storing card data can be led to the sensitivity of network signal by the reception signal of data service
Decline.

By taking storage card working frequency is 50MHz as an example, if the bandwidth of operation of current network includes times frequency point of 50MHz, example
Such as the frequency point of 2300MHz, 2350MHz, then determine that there are what the signal of the data transmission interference radio circuit of storage card transmitted to ask
Topic.

As shown in figure 3, for the antenna of terminal inner and the schematic layout pattern of storage card, with the radio circuit of wireless network
For the second antenna of the first antenna at a distance from storage card greater than main radio circuit is at a distance from storage card, terminal includes: electricity
Pond 31 and printed circuit board (Printed Circuit Board, PCB) 32 include wireless radio frequency circuit module on pcb board
33 and main RF circuit module 34, wherein wireless radio frequency circuit module 33 passes through first antenna and receives and transmitting signal, main radio frequency
Circuit module 34 receives by the second antenna and emits signal, by taking first antenna is relatively close apart from 35 position of storage card as an example, makes
When being worked with wireless network, the reception signal frequency range of wireless network is 2402~2482MHz, when wireless network downloading data
While resource (film, client etc.) is surfed the Internet to storage card or wireless network, the transmitting data resources of downloading to storage card
In, then storage card is there are data transmission, since storage card work hours are 50MHz according to the frequency of signal wire, the of wireless network
The reception signal frequency range of one antenna includes times frequency point of frequency when storing card data transmits, then it is assumed that storing card data passes
The reception signal of the defeated radio circuit to wireless network generates interference.
Equally, if the second antenna of main radio circuit is close to the storage card, when being worked using LTE network, second
Antenna receives the working frequency points of signal when in the frequency multiplication of 50MHz, as LTE network downloading data resource to storage card or LTE
While network is surfed the Internet, in the transmitting data resources to storage card of downloading, then there are data transmission for storage card, due to storage card work
The frequency of data signal line is 50MHz when making, and the reception signal frequency range of the second antenna of LTE network includes storing card data
Times frequency point of frequency when transmission, then it is assumed that storing card data, which transmits to generate the reception signal of the radio circuit of wireless network, to be done
It disturbs.
It should be noted that Fig. 3 is only the antenna of terminal inner and the example of storage card layout, the position of antenna and storage card
It sets and is arranged according to the actual design of terminal.
